CVE-2015-7990 |
Race condition in the rds_sendmsg function in net/rds/sendmsg.c in the Linux kernel before 4.3.3 allows local users to cause a denial of service (NULL pointer dereference and system crash) or possibly have unspecified other impact by using a socket that was not properly bound. NOTE: this vulnerability exists because of an incomplete fix for CVE-2015-6937. Published: December 28, 2015; 6:59:04 AM -0500 |
V4.0:(not available) V3.0: 5.8 MEDIUM V2.0: 5.9 MEDIUM |

CVE-2015-7665 |
Tails before 1.7 includes the wget program but does not prevent automatic fallback from passive FTP to active FTP, which allows remote FTP servers to discover the Tor client IP address by reading a (1) PORT or (2) EPRT command. NOTE: within wget itself, the automatic fallback is not considered a vulnerability by CVE. Published: December 27, 2015; 2:59:02 PM -0500 |
V4.0:(not available) V3.0: 5.3 MEDIUM V2.0: 5.0 MEDIUM |

CVE-2015-8254 |
The Frontel protocol before 3 on RSI Video Technologies Videofied devices does not use integrity protection, which makes it easier for man-in-the-middle attackers to (1) initiate a false alarm or (2) deactivate an alarm by modifying the client-server data stream. Published: December 26, 2015; 10:59:04 PM -0500 |
V4.0:(not available) V3.0: 5.9 MEDIUM V2.0: 4.3 MEDIUM |
CVE-2015-8253 |
The Frontel protocol before 3 on RSI Video Technologies Videofied devices sets up AES encryption but sends all traffic in cleartext, which allows remote attackers to obtain sensitive (1) message or (2) MJPEG video data by sniffing the network. Published: December 26, 2015; 10:59:03 PM -0500 |
V4.0:(not available) V3.0: 3.7 LOW V2.0: 4.3 MEDIUM |
CVE-2015-8252 |
The Frontel protocol before 3 on RSI Video Technologies Videofied devices sends a cleartext serial number, which allows remote attackers to determine a hardcoded key by sniffing the network and performing a "jumbled up" calculation with this number. Published: December 26, 2015; 10:59:02 PM -0500 |
V4.0:(not available) V3.0: 5.9 MEDIUM V2.0: 4.3 MEDIUM |
